Amd S459-c, RPT L
 
Exempts from real property taxation real property owned by a person certified to receive a United States department of veterans affairs disability pension pursuant to 38 U.S.C. 1521; allows an award letter from the United States department of veterans affairs to be submitted as proof of disability.

        AN ACT to amend the real property tax law, in relation to exempting from
          real  property  taxation  real property owned by a person certified to

          receive a United States  department  of  veterans  affairs  disability
          pension
 
          The  People of the State of New York, represented in Senate and Assem-
        bly, do enact as follows:
 
     1    Section 1. Paragraph (b) and the closing paragraph of subdivision 2 of
     2  section 459-c of the real property tax law, as amended by chapter 421 of
     3  the laws of 2000, are amended to read as follows:
     4    (b) a person with a disability is one who has  a  physical  or  mental
     5  impairment, not due to current use of alcohol or illegal drug use, which
     6  substantially  limits  such  person's  ability  to engage in one or more
     7  major life activities, such as caring for one's self, performing  manual
     8  tasks, walking, seeing, hearing, speaking, breathing, learning and work-
     9  ing,  and  who  (i)  is  certified to receive social security disability

    10  insurance (SSDI) or supplemental security income  (SSI)  benefits  under
    11  the  federal  Social Security Act, or (ii) is certified to receive Rail-
    12  road Retirement Disability benefits under the federal  railroad  Retire-
    13  ment  Act, or (iii) has received a certificate from the state commission
    14  for the blind and visually  handicapped  stating  that  such  person  is
    15  legally  blind,  or  (iv) is certified to receive a United States Postal
    16  Service disability pension, or (v) is  certified  to  receive  a  United
    17  States  department of veterans affairs disability pension pursuant to 38
    18  U.S.C. §1521.
    19    An award letter from the Social Security Administration or  the  Rail-
    20  road  Retirement  Board,  or a certificate from the state commission for
    21  the blind and visually handicapped, or an award letter from  the  United
